Paint that has peeled or chipped

Frames and window sills are typically close to the elements, which means they take a lot of damage from precipitation and sunlight. Moisture is the main reason for the peeling of paint around windows, particularly if the wood is exposed. The water seeps into wood and when it evaporates, the pressure in the film of paint causes it to lose adhesion and peel. Moisture can come from condensation in the interior, or from rain and Window Repairs snow on the outside. It is essential to sand and scrape the surface as soon as you see the paint begin to chip. Some skilled painters apply a water repellent preserver to the wood that is unfinished and then thinned with boiling oil prior to painting. This will help slow the penetration of moisture into the wood, which will help the new paint to hold better.

When paint begins to crack, it’s time to repair your window. Before applying a new coat, put a drop cloth or tarp over the area you’re working on to catch any stray drops of paint. Get rid of any paint that has fallen off using a utility knife. Be careful not to slash the wood beneath or cut into the sheathing. Clean the area thoroughly and allow it to dry completely.

Once the surface is dry, sand the area again with a fine sanding pad. This will prepare the surface for primer and create a surface that is ready for paint. If you’re working with lead-based paints ensure you’re using the proper safety equipment. Clean the sanded surface and tape off any adjacent surfaces, such as baseboards, to protect them from paint.

Then paint, prime and then paint according to the instructions on the specific tin of paint you’re using. Follow the curing and temperature instructions on the paint’s can because they’ll differ depending on the type of paint. Paint the exterior with exterior grade paint, and the interior surface with interior-grade.

Window replacement can be costly, but repairing chipped or peeling paint is relatively inexpensive and is an effective alternative to replacing the entire frame. If your window frames are beyond repair, it could be worthwhile to upgrade them to newer windows that are more energy efficient.
